Award-winning comedian Jimmy Carr will perform an extra date at Lincoln’s Engine Shed due to high demand.
As previously reported, the tour named Jimmy Carr: Terribly Funny was due to come to the city on October 3. That date was postponed due to unforeseen medical circumstances for the comedian, and it was re-arranged for November 3.
Due to high demand a second date was added on November 15 and both dates sold out very quickly.
The comedian is proving so popular in the city that the Engine Shed has added a third performance on Friday, April 3, 2020 (doors open at 6.15pm).
The blurb for the show Jimmy Carr: Terribly Funny says: “Jimmy’s brand new show contains jokes about all kinds of terrible things. Terrible things that might have affected you or people you know and love. But they’re just jokes – they are not the terrible things.
“Having political correctness at a comedy show is like having health and safety at a rodeo. Now you’ve been warned, buy a ticket.”
